Formed in 2007 the band performs organic, off the cuff arrangements of classic jazz hits and from the 1920s and 1930s.
The highly experienced group make a feature of vocal numbers as well as top notch 1920's instrumentals.
With a massive repertoire including favourites such as; A Nightingale Sang In Berkeley Square, Dinah, You're Driving Me Crazy, Georgia On My Mind, Honeysuckle Rose, Moonglow, Tea for Two and When You're Smiling, 1920's Street are the band to hire for your 1920's themed party.
